West Chester Hospital offers access to the region's largest group of specialized physicians and medical providers. Known for outstanding patient experiences and quality care, it ranks among the top 5% nationally.
The hospital features a Level III Trauma Center for emergency and critical care, a certified Primary Stroke Center providing subspecialty care through the UC Gardner Neuroscience Institute, and has achieved Magnet Recognition for nursing excellence from the ANCC. The police officer will perform general duty work to protect life and property, enforce laws, and uphold UC Health policies across all properties. Duties vary from physical inactivity to situations requiring significant exertion and potential danger.
